The HP L40 48GB GDDR6 PCI Express 4.0 Passive Accelerator Graphics Card is a high-capacity solution designed to handle demanding computational and graphical workloads in professional environments. It fits into PCIe 4.0 slots, delivering fast data throughput while its passive cooling system allows it to operate quietly in dense workstation and server configurations. |

The HP L40 48GB GDDR6 PCI Express 4.0 Passive Accelerator Graphics Card provides powerful graphics processing with a large memory capacity. It is built for compute-heavy workloads that require fast access to large amounts of data, such as 3D rendering, simulation, and machine learning. Often found in professional workstations and data center servers, this card runs quietly thanks to its passive cooling system, making it well-suited for environments where low noise is important.
